Collecting NFL salary cap data is an inexact science at best. The information posted below is only as accurate as the reports published by the media. It also includes best guesses to plug holes where the media reports are lacking. This page would not be possible without the initial efforts of "AJ" Burge and the others who have helped both him and myself.

looking ahead to 2006:

Zach Weigert
McKinney
Billy Miller

...will all be cut or forced to restructure. Weigert and McKinney would save $3 million each if they were cut and Billy Miller would save the team almost $1 million.

Perhaps some of the OL shuffling and pursuing free agents, etc... has more to do with looking ahead. Weary and Washington will both be UFA.
